While libraries represent a phenomenal free resource, several other avenues can supplement your professional development: * **Professional Organizations:** Organizations like the American Speech-Language-Hearing Association (ASHA) often offer free webinars or discounted access to resources for their members. While not entirely free, the membership fees often outweigh the cost of individual CEU courses. * **University Websites:** Many universities post lectures, presentations, and research papers online. While not always explicitly marketed as CEUs, these materials can provide valuable professional development and contribute to maintaining a high level of competency. * **Government Websites:** Websites like the National Institutes of Health (NIH) and the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) offer valuable resources and publications relevant to SLP practice. * **Free Online Courses (MOOCs):** Platforms like Coursera, edX, and FutureLearn sometimes offer courses related to speech therapy or related fields. While not all courses might offer CEUs directly, the knowledge gained is undeniably valuable and can contribute to your overall professional growth. * **YouTube Channels and Podcasts:** While not always formally accredited for CEUs, many YouTube channels and podcasts dedicated to SLP provide informative content that can supplement your professional knowledge. Remember to always check the credibility of the source.Navigating the Landscape: Tips for Identifying Quality Free CEUs
Not all free resources are created equal. It's crucial to discern credible sources from less reliable ones. Here are some tips: * **Check for Accreditation:** If the resource claims to offer CEUs, verify its accreditation with your state licensing board or professional organization. * **Assess the Source's Credibility:** Look for reputable authors, institutions, or organizations associated with the material. Peer-reviewed articles and presentations from recognized experts carry more weight. * **Evaluate the Content's Relevance:** Ensure the material aligns with your professional goals and addresses current best practices in your specific area of SLP practice. * **Look for Evidence-Based Practices:** Prioritize resources that emphasize evidence-based practices and research findings. * **Read Reviews and Testimonials:** If available, check reviews or testimonials to gauge the quality and value of the content.Maintaining a Balanced Approach: The Value of Paid CEUs
